A Sterile Wound Probe is a single-use medical instrument designed to assess the depth, direction, and characteristics of wounds without causing additional trauma. Manufactured from medical-grade plastic or stainless steel, it ensures hygienic, contamination-free examination. Commonly used in emergency care, surgical dressing rooms, minor procedure units, and veterinary clinics, it helps clinicians evaluate injuries safely and efficiently.

Q1. What is a Sterile Wound Probe? A Sterile Wound Probe is a blunt, single-use instrument used to examine and measure wound depth safely.
Q2. Can it cause pain or injury? Not usually — its rounded, blunt tip is designed to minimise discomfort and tissue trauma.
Q3. Is it reusable? No. Sterile wound probes are single-use to prevent infection.
Q4. What sterilisation method is used? They are sterilised with Ethylene Oxide (EO).
Q5. Is it suitable for veterinary use? Yes, it is widely used in animal wound assessment in veterinary medicine.
